WebJan 28, 2016 · Animal ethics, with some historical exceptions (some going back to antiquity), is largely a product of the second half of the twentieth century. We may distinguish even within this short time a variety of approaches. WebJul 19, 2024 · In order to prevent undue suffering, ethical considerations in animal studies are important. Generally, before experiments on animals are conducted, the research protocol must be reviewed by animal ethics committees. The guiding principle of these committees is usually the 3 Rs.
